Ingredients

Here’s what you need for this classic Thai street dish:

  • 250g rice noodles
  • 200g chicken or shrimp, diced
  • 1 tablespoon sesame oil
  • 2 garlic cloves, minced
  • 2 tablespoons soy sauce
  • 1 tablespoon fish sauce
  • 1 tablespoon sugar
  • 1 egg
  • 250g mixed vegetables, such as carrots, bell peppers, and snow peas
  • Fresh coriander for garnishing
  • Lime juice for serving

Directions

  1. Cook the rice noodles according to package instructions. Drain and set aside.
  2. In a large pan or wok, heat the sesame oil over medium heat. Add the minced garlic and sauté until golden.
  3. Add the chicken or shrimp and cook until fully cooked.
  4. Add the mixed vegetables and cook until tender.
  5. Push the ingredients to one side of the pan, crack the egg on the other side, and scramble it.
  6. Add the rice noodles, soy sauce, fish sauce, and sugar. Mix well to combine all ingredients.
  7. Serve hot, garnished with fresh coriander and lime juice.

Troubleshooting/Variations

Sometimes, things don’t go as planned. In case the noodle clumps together, fear not! Splashing in a little hot water while stirring helps to loosen them. This maintains a pleasant texture rather than ending up with a mash of noodles.

Pairings/Storage

Pairing the classic Thai street dish with refreshing beverages, such as iced tea or sparkling water, complements the meal. Opt for light, fragrant drinks that won’t overpower delicate flavors.

Storing leftovers ensures that the deliciousness doesn’t go to waste. Store any remaining portions in an airtight container in the refrigerator, where they’ll stay fresh for up to three days. Reheating gently helps maintain texture.
